site stats

Sql create table constraints

WebFeb 22, 2024 · Option 1 creates 7 constraints of which there are 3 pairs of duplicate constraints (where each pair has a user-named and a system-named constraint) Option 2 … WebFeb 2, 2016 · As far as an actual constraint to prevent the insertion-of negative values, MySQL has a CHECK clause that can be used in the CREATE TABLE statement, however, according to the documentation: The CHECK clause is parsed but ignored by …

SQL SERVER: Create table with named default constraint

WebMay 12, 2015 · Right Click -> Check Constraints -> Add -> Type something like Frequency IN ('Daily', 'Weekly', 'Monthly', 'Yearly') in expression field and a good constraint name in (Name) field. You are done. Share Improve this answer Follow answered Mar 14, 2010 at 7:07 Denis K 1,438 1 10 17 Add a comment Your Answer Post Your Answer WebDec 23, 2024 · To create a new database, in SSMS right click on Databases, select New Database and enter your Database name. Since, we are talking about T-SQL here, let's quickly create a database using a T-SQL statement, CREATE DATABASE. Execute the below command to create this database. CREATE DATABASE DemoDB. community health center of central missouri https://stephenquehl.com

oracle - SQL Creating a Table with constraints - Stack …

WebOct 25, 2024 · PRIMARY KEY constraint differs from the UNIQUE constraint in that; you can create multiple UNIQUE constraints in a table, with the ability to define only one SQL PRIMARY KEY per each table. Another difference is that the UNIQUE constraint allows for one NULL value, but the PRIMARY KEY does not allow NULL values. WebCREATE TABLE will create a new, initially empty table in the current database. The table will be owned by the user issuing the command. If a schema name is given (for example, CREATE TABLE myschema.mytable ...) then the table is created in the specified schema. Otherwise it is created in the current schema. WebFirst, we will create a table with the name Department by using the PRIMARY KEY constraint by executing the below CREATE Table query. This table is going to be the parent table or master table which contains the reference key column. Here, we created the reference column (Id) using the Primary Key constraint. community health center of central mo

How to check if a Constraint exists in Sql server?

Category:SQL FOREIGN KEY - W3School

Tags:Sql create table constraints

Sql create table constraints

SQL - CREATE Table - TutorialsPoint

Web7 hours ago · SQLSTATE[HY000]: General error: 1005 Can't create table gym_management.users (errno: 150 "Foreign key constraint is incorrectly formed") (SQL: alter table users add constraint users_role_id_foreign foreign key … WebAug 19, 2024 · Use this method if you want to create tables and insert data stored in specific columns in another table. Here’s the syntax: CREATE TABLE new_table_name SELECT col1, col2, … FROM existing_table_name ; First we provide the CREATE TABLE keyword and the new table name. Next, we use the SELECT command.

Sql create table constraints

Did you know?

WebTo create a new table containing a foreign key column that references another table, use the keyword FOREIGN KEY REFERENCES at the end of the definition of that column. Follow that with the name of the referenced table and the name of the referenced column in parentheses. In our example, we create the table student using a CREATE TABLE clause. WebMay 5, 2014 · CREATE TABLE NEW_TABLE ( EMP_NUM NUMBER (5, 0) NOT NULL PRIMARY KEY, RTG_CODE CHAR (5 BYTE) NOT NULL FOREIGN KEY REFERENCES RTG …

WebDec 5, 2024 · SQL Create Table statement In database theory, a table is a structure (“basic unit”) used to store data in the database. I love to use analogies a lot, so I’ll do it here too. If you think of a library, a database is one shelf with books, and each book is a table. WebSep 13, 2024 · SQL constraints are used to specify the rules for the data in a table. Constraints can be specified at the time of creating the table. We have the following …

WebDec 29, 2024 · Defines a table constraint on a user-defined table type. Supported constraints include PRIMARY KEY, UNIQUE, and CHECK. Specifies the error response to duplicate key values in a multiple-row insert operation on a unique clustered or unique nonclustered index. For more information about index options, see CREATE INDEX … WebOct 27, 2024 · Use this syntax: CREATE TABLE table1 ( field1 varchar (25) CONSTRAINT [df_table1_field1] DEFAULT ('a') ) Have a look at MS Docs about Specify Default Values for …

WebJul 6, 2024 · ADD CONSTRAINT is a SQL command that is used together with ALTER TABLE to add constraints (such as a primary key or foreign key) to an existing table in a SQL …

WebForeign Key in SQL Server: The Foreign Key in SQL Server is a field in a table that is a unique key in another table. A Foreign Key can accept both null values and duplicate values in SQL Server. By default, the foreign key does not create any index. If you need then you can create an index on the foreign key column manually. community health center of hillsboroughWebHow to define constraints while creating a table? We can also add different types of constraints while creating a table. For example, CREATE TABLE Companies ( id int NOT NULL, name varchar(50) NOT NULL, address text, email varchar(50) NOT NULL, phone varchar(10) ); Run Code community health center of jefferson cityWebSQL Server Constraints with Example. This article describes SQL server constraints like Primary key, not null, Unique, Check, Default, and foreign key with examples. It also gives … community health center of franklin county maWebNov 19, 2024 · SQL constraints are generally used to create a database structure and make all the applications that use this database conform to our rules. As constraints are … community health center of lubbock incWebWe can define the SQL Server Constraint as a property that can be assigned to a column or columns of a table. The SQL Server Constraints are mainly used to maintain data integrity. ... In order to understand this, first, create the Employee table by executing the following SQL Script. CREATE TABLE Employee ( ID int NOT NULL, LastName varchar ... community health center of ctWebCreate an employee table and apply the FOREIGN KEY constraint with a constraint name while creating a table. To create a foreign key on any table, first, we need to create a primary key on a table. mysql> CREATE TABLE employee (Emp_ID INT NOT NULL PRIMARY KEY, Emp_Name VARCHAR (40), Emp_Salary VARCHAR (40)); community health center of edmondsWebThe following simple SQL creates table Doctor with one constraint, doctor_id as a primary key: sql. Create table doctor ( doctor_id int PRIMARY KEY, name varchar ( 20 ), age int, gender varchar ( 10 ), address varchar ( 25) ); Once we execute the above query, it shows the message of ‘table created successfully’. community health center of central washington